Yeah, Matango is such a hauntingly beautiful, almost poetic film. If you like Matango, Goke, Body Snatcher from Hell is kind of similar in its set-up and themes. Those two films along with Nakagawa's Jigoku are pretty much my favorite Japanese cult fantasy/horror films of the 60s.

Godzilla vs. Mechagodzilla (I'm assuming you're talking about the 1974 one) is way fun. One of my favorite Jun Fukuda-directed entries. King Seasar is awesome. The US version is pretty similar to the Japanese. The original US version had some violence cut and the last minute of the film chopped, but the most commonly seen version of the movie distributed by New World Video from the 80s on, shown on Sci-Fi, etc, is the international version which is uncut. The real problem with any US version of the film is how horrible the dubbing is, a problem pretty much remedied on Sony's DVD (though the subtitles are dubtitles, sadly).

Jigoku was pretty freaking weird, that ending, this must have been Miike and Lynch's favorite movie.

Nobuo Nakagawa was always one of Japan's most underrated filmmakers. While Jigoku is his goriest film, I think Ghost of Yotsuya is his masterpiece, though it's very hard to pick. That story (Yotsuya Kaidan) has been lensed a million times by so many other Japanese filmmakers, including Shiro Toyoda (Illusion of Blood) and Kinji Fukasaku (Crest of Betrayal). but Nakagawa's, at least as far as pure horror goes, is the best, IMHO.
